Several executives and staff members of Mahidol University International College (MUIC) attended the Asia-Pacific Association for International Education (APAIE) Conference 2025 in Delhi, India from March 23 to 27, 2025.

Asst. Prof. Dale Alan Konstanz, Associate Dean for International Affairs, along with members of his team; together with Assoc. Prof. Dr. Claus Schreier, Assistant Dean for Research and Academic Services, had the privilege of attending  the APAIE Conference 2025, an event that brought together thought leaders, educators, and international affairs professionals from across the globe.

Asst. Prof. Konstanz said, “As the Associate Dean of International Affairs at MUIC, this conference provided a unique opportunity to exchange ideas, foster new partnerships, and stay at the forefront of international education trends.”

He added that the event was a hub for innovative discussions on global educational practices, challenges, enabling him to connect with delegates from prestigious institutions such as: Monash Business School, University of Melbourne, Università Cattolica Milan, University of Campinas, SOAS, HdM Stuttgart, University of Barcelona, University of British Columbia, University of Technology Sydney (UTS), Heidelberg University, University of Konstanz, and Lucerne University of Applied Sciences and Arts, among many others.
